Deborah Dalzell


Debra Dalzell

 

Deborah Dalzell residence
at 5356 Colony Meadows Lane

On March 29, 1999, at approximately 1120 hrs., the Sarasota County Sheriff’s Office was dispatched to the residence of Deborah Dalzell. Co-workers became concerned when she had not shown up for work at KMC-Telecom in Sarasota and responded to her residence to check on her. The last known contact with Deborah Dalzell was on the evening of March 28, 1999.

Sarasota County Sheriff’s Office Deputies found Deborah deceased inside her residence. The cause of death was determined to be homicidal violence.

The investigation revealed signs of forced entry into the residence.
